Title
Stored XSS in CrushFTP
Summary
Improper input handling in the 'Host Header' allows an unauthenticated attacker to store a payload in web application logs. When an Administrator views the logs using the application's standard functionality, it enables the execution of the payload, resulting in Stored XSS or 'Cross-Site Scripting'.
CWE
  • CWE-79 -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ation (XSS or 'Cross-site Scripting')
Assigner
Impacted products
Vendor Product Version
CrushFTP, LLC CrushFTP Affected: 10.0.0 , < 10.8.2 (semver)
Affected: 11.0.0 , < 11.2.1 (semver)
